The 2012 Summer Olympic Games are a few months away in London, and that means that an Olympic torch is progressing somewhere through the British Empire.  It was 11 years ago that the Olympic spirit was felt in Utica as the torch passed through before the 2002 Salt Lake City Winter Olympics.

Dave Williams carries the Olympic Torch through Oneida Square in Utica.  That would look different today as this took place years before the roundabout was installed on Genesee Street.
